Autumn Tomasello

Autumn Tomasello (nee Gordon) is the first-ever associate head coach of the John Carroll Women's Wrestling program. She began her role on August 31, 2022, entering her third year on the job in the 2024-25 academic year. 

In the program's first campaign in 2023-24, Tomasello guided the program to success. The program was unveiled in front of a fantastic crowd in the Tony DeCarlo Varsity Center on November 1, 2023. During the season, JCU notched three dual wins. Jordan Palmer, Talia Mitchell, and Delaney Burns all punched tickets to the National Collegiate Women's Wrestling Championships.

Tomasello joined the Blue Streaks from nearby Lutheran West High School, where she spent the 2020-21 and 2021-22 seasons. Lutheran West stands out as the top girl's wrestling team in Northeast Ohio. The Longhorns have been pioneers in the sport by being one of the first schools to have coaches specifically for the girls program. Lutheran West proved to be instrumental in the sanctioning of girl's wrestling by the OHSAA in the spring of 2022. 

As a wrestler, Autumn has a long list of accomplishments highlighted by a USA Wrestling Junior Folkstyle National Championship in 2017. She was the runner-up at the same tournament in 2016.  

In freestyle wrestling, Autumn placed 2nd at the prestigious Junior National Championships in Fargo, North Dakota. She has also placed in the US Senior Nationals, the U23 World Team Trials, and the Junior World Team Trials.  

Gordon is a Lancaster, Ohio native who wrestled at Lancaster High School. She matriculated to the University of the Cumberlands in Williamsburg, Kentucky. She wrestled there for a time, but suffered a career-ending injury in college. 

Additionally, Autumn is an active competitor in Brazilian Jiu Jitsu. She was a Junior World Champion, a senior World Bronze Medalist, and a Senior Pan Am Champion. Autumn will be competing in the World Championships once again in December 2022. 

Gordon has also worked as a Personal Trainer and Jiu Jitsu Coach at RTSC Training Center and a trainer at Planet Fitness. In addition to her B.S. Biology with an Exercise Sports Science Minor from the University of the Cumberlands, she is pursuing a Masters in Clinical Mental Health Counseling. 

John Carroll announced the launch of Women's Wrestling in July 2022. The Blue Streaks will begin competition in time for the 2023-24 academic year.

Autumn is married to Nathan Tomasello, an NCAA Champion and 4x Big Ten wrestler for Ohio State.
